Opioid-associated overdoses and deaths resulting from respiratory despair are a major public wellbeing problem inside the US together with other Western countries. Previously 10 years, Substantially research effort and hard work continues to be directed in the direction of the development of G-protein-biased µ-opioid receptor (MOP) agonists like a achievable suggests to avoid this problem. The bias hypothesis proposes that G-protein signaling mediates analgesia, whereas ß-arrestin signaling mediates respiratory depression. SR-17018 was at first noted as being a very biased µ-opioid with a very large therapeutic window. It was afterwards proven that SR-17018 can also reverse morphine tolerance and stop withdrawal by way of a hitherto unfamiliar mechanism of action. Here, we examined the temporal dynamics of SR-17018-induced MOP phosphorylation and dephosphorylation. Exposure of MOP to saturating concentrations of SR-17018 for prolonged periods of time stimulated a MOP phosphorylation pattern which was indistinguishable from that induced by the complete agonist DAMGO.
